What are Autonomous Mobile Robots main advantages?
1. More Flexibility
Autonomous Mobile Robots have a flexible, fluid automation because of their dependence on cameras and onboard sensors. Autonomous Mobile Robots can develop their own efficient routes within a facility. Autonomous Mobile Robots avoid following established routes and therefore are open to new routes. 2. Safety - Increased
Autonomous Mobile Robots are packed to the gills with cameras and sensors. These enable the Autonomous Mobile Robot's ability to perceive and understand the environment around it. It can travel in an area efficiently, without having to come upon people, goods infrastructure, or even people. The equipment operated by humans, such as forklifts do not have the same safety mechanisms and relies on the input of humans. Autonomous Mobile Robots can be used to perform repeatable tasks which reduces the chance of human error and greatly improves safety.
3. Rapid Implementation
Autonomous Mobile Robots can be implemented during an operation within four to six weeks, depending on the specifics of the operation. It is crucial to pick the software and warehouse execution programs which the units have to be integrated with. Even at the top end this is not a long time, especially when compared to other technologies. It could take upto one year for a goods-to- person (G2P), system to be fully in place.
4. Ability to increase scale
Autonomous Mobile Robots can be implemented within the facility in a simple manner. It is possible to follow the modular approach to deployment, starting with a few units, and then increasing the number when you require them. You can start small and build your fleet as you go. This can save you a lot of cash upfront. Modular deployments save money and allows you to put money into other projects. Additionally, you are able to evaluate the effects Autonomous Mobile Robots have on your business and decide what next steps to take.

Autonomous Mobile Robots can be deployed quickly and relocated between facilities. This lets automation be implemented even in the short term. This is an advantage for businesses that are planning to establish temporary holiday operations.
